Am Donnerstag 05 März 2009 17:55:29 schrieb [email protected]: > Hi All, > > by following this guide: > http://wiki.openmoko.org/wiki/Stable_Hybrid_Release > I've installed SHR Testing. > > Question: > while updating the repos packages, I get the following error: > > > r...@om-gta02 ~ $ opkg update > Downloading http://build.shr-project.org/shr-testing/ipk//all/Packages.gz > Inflating http://build.shr-project.org/shr-testing/ipk//all/Packages.gz > Updated list of available packages in /var/lib/opkg/shr-all > Downloading http://build.shr-project.org/shr-testing/ipk//armv4/Packages.gz > Downloading > http://build.shr-project.org/shr-testing/ipk//armv4t/Packages.gz Inflating > http://build.shr-project.org/shr-testing/ipk//armv4t/Packages.gz Updated > list of available packages in /var/lib/opkg/shr-armv4t > Downloading > http://build.shr-project.org/shr-testing/ipk//om-gta02/Packages.gz > Inflating > http://build.shr-project.org/shr-testing/ipk//om-gta02/Packages.gz Updated > list of available packages in /var/lib/opkg/shr-om-gta02 > Collected errors: > * Failed to download > http://build.shr-project.org/shr-testing/ipk//armv4/Packages.gz, error 404 > > > Is that a temporary issue or shall I modify smth on my soap ? you can either ignore it (like I do mostly) or rm /etc/opkg/armv4-feed.conf. It is a bogus feed that does not exist and we do not get rid of (or did not look into it enough yet). Not needed though.
